Transaction 80ed3e6a7a27f0cca2250b9294abed2b4cf0c3267c9799aec2aa0aeb176d3f56
2 Input
2 Outputs
- 80ed3e6a7a27f0cca2250b9294abed2b4cf0c3267c9799aec2aa0aeb176d3f56:0
- 80ed3e6a7a27f0cca2250b9294abed2b4cf0c3267c9799aec2aa0aeb176d3f56:1
value 490065
address 3E2AFG8dJmMgqDq3YXvSWXLwaSPPUef7Ku
value 26693
address 13j2tYS11PY8MC79CmHr4rUPo4ETquhbo8